-
公开(公告)号:US11412350B2
公开(公告)日:2022-08-09
申请号:US16576573
申请日:2019-09-19
Applicant: Apple Inc.
Inventor: Robert William Mayor , Isaac T. Miller , Adam S. Howell , Vinay R. Majjigi , Oliver Ruepp , Daniel Ulbricht , Oleg Naroditsky , Christian Lipski , Sean P. Cier , Hyojoon Bae , Saurabh Godha , Patrick J. Coleman
Abstract: Location mapping and navigation user interfaces may be generated and presented via mobile computing devices. A mobile device may detect its location and orientation using internal systems, and may capture image data using a device camera. The mobile device also may retrieve map information from a map server corresponding to the current location of the device. Using the image data captured at the device, the current location data, and the corresponding local map information, the mobile device may determine or update a current orientation reading for the device. Location errors and updated location data also may be determined for the device, and a map user interface may be generated and displayed on the mobile device using the updated device orientation and/or location data.
-
公开(公告)号:US20240401958A1
公开(公告)日:2024-12-05
申请号:US18680791
申请日:2024-05-31
Applicant: Apple Inc.
Inventor: Saurabh Godha , James T. Curran , Fatemeh Ghafoori , Changlin Ma , Isaac T. Miller
IPC: G01C21/34
Abstract: Techniques are described for improving driver efficiency. An example method can include a device accessing sparse location data indicative of one or more geographic locations along a route of the user device during a first time period. The route includes a starting location data point and an ending location data point. The device can access motion data collected by the sensors of the user device. The motion data can be collected by the sensors during the first time period. After a conclusion of the first time period, the device can generate, using the sparse location data and the motion data, a dense data set to reconstruct a route that includes the starting location data point and the ending location data point. The reconstructed route can include second dense location data and velocity data. The device can store the reconstructed route in a local memory of the user device.
-
公开(公告)号:US11109192B2
公开(公告)日:2021-08-31
申请号:US16417478
申请日:2019-05-20
Applicant: Apple Inc.
Inventor: Isaac T. Miller , Benjamin A. Werner , Changlin Ma , Christina Selle , Saurabh Godha , Mark G. Petovello
IPC: H04W4/029
Abstract: A device implementing a system for estimating device location includes at least one processor configured to estimate a first position of a device based on a first set of parameters, the first set of parameters derived from first sensor data obtained on the device, the first set of parameters corresponding to device motion. The at least one processor is configured to estimate a second position of a user of the device based on a second set of parameters, the second set of parameters derived from second sensor data obtained on the device, the second set of parameters corresponding to user motion. Estimating the first and second positions is constrained by a predefined relationship between the device motion and the user motion. The at least one processor is configured to provide at least one of the first position of the device or the second position of the user.
-
公开(公告)号:US20230358845A1
公开(公告)日:2023-11-09
申请号:US18304104
申请日:2023-04-20
Applicant: Apple Inc.
Inventor: Christina Selle , Bharath Narasimha Rao , Saurabh Godha , Andrew J. Kerns , Adam M. Driscoll , Gunes Dervisoglu , Archana Belvadi , Jong-Ki Lee , Girish Joshi , Halil Ibrahim Basturk , Seyyedeh Mahsa Mirzargar , Jonathan M. Beard , Richard Najarian
CPC classification number: G01S5/02521 , H04W64/003 , H04L5/0048 , H04W52/0229
Abstract: Methods, non-transitory machine-readable mediums, and system to provide location services are described. In an embodiment, a method provides receiving at least two position fixes for a trajectory of an electronic device, where the at least two position fixes are obtained intermittently, matching the at least two position fixes to points on a path indicated in map data, and computing a distance for the trajectory using distance information using the map data.
-
公开(公告)号:US20220345849A1
公开(公告)日:2022-10-27
申请号:US17861167
申请日:2022-07-08
Applicant: Apple Inc.
Inventor: Robert William Mayor , Isaac T. Miller , Adam S. Howell , Vinay R. Majjigi , Oliver Ruepp , Daniel Ulbricht , Oleg Naroditsky , Christian Lipski , Sean P. Cier , Hyojoon Bae , Saurabh Godha , Patrick J. Coleman
Abstract: Location mapping and navigation user interfaces may be generated and presented via mobile computing devices. A mobile device may detect its location and orientation using internal systems, and may capture image data using a device camera. The mobile device also may retrieve map information from a map server corresponding to the current location of the device. Using the image data captured at the device, the current location data, and the corresponding local map information, the mobile device may determine or update a current orientation reading for the device. Location errors and updated location data also may be determined for the device, and a map user interface may be generated and displayed on the mobile device using the updated device orientation and/or location data.
-
公开(公告)号:US12055403B2
公开(公告)日:2024-08-06
申请号:US16583195
申请日:2019-09-25
Applicant: Apple Inc.
Inventor: Saurabh Godha , Hyojoon Bae , Isaac T. Miller , Robert W. Mayor
Abstract: A device implementing a system for estimating device orientation includes at least one processor configured to obtain a first estimate for a heading of a device, the first estimate being based on output from a magnetometer of the device. The at least one processor is further configured to capture image data using an image sensor of the device, and determine at least one second estimate of the heading based on correlating the image data with mapping data. The at least one processor is further configured to determine a bias associated with output of the magnetometer based on the first estimate and the at least one second estimate, and adjusting output of the magnetometer based on the determined bias.
-
公开(公告)号:US20200084583A1
公开(公告)日:2020-03-12
申请号:US16417478
申请日:2019-05-20
Applicant: Apple Inc.
Inventor: Isaac T. Miller , Benjamin A. Werner , Changlin Ma , Christina Selle , Saurabh Godha , Mark G. Petovello
IPC: H04W4/029
Abstract: A device implementing a system for estimating device location includes at least one processor configured to estimate a first position of a device based on a first set of parameters, the first set of parameters derived from first sensor data obtained on the device, the first set of parameters corresponding to device motion. The at least one processor is configured to estimate a second position of a user of the device based on a second set of parameters, the second set of parameters derived from second sensor data obtained on the device, the second set of parameters corresponding to user motion. Estimating the first and second positions is constrained by a predefined relationship between the device motion and the user motion. The at least one processor is configured to provide at least one of the first position of the device or the second position of the user.
-
公开(公告)号:US12163790B2
公开(公告)日:2024-12-10
申请号:US17739074
申请日:2022-05-06
Applicant: Apple Inc.
Inventor: Kenneth M. Pesyna, Jr. , Christina Selle , Saurabh Godha , Isaac Thomas Miller
IPC: G01C21/30
Abstract: The subject technology provides for visualizing a route traversed by a user during a movement event by periodically obtaining position information data from a receiver of a navigation system during a movement event. A path traversed by a user of a device that includes the receiver during the movement event is estimated based on the position information data. One or more previously mapped features within a proximity of the estimated path on a map are determined. The estimated path is matched to the map based on the previously mapped features to obtain a map-matched path. A display device is caused to render the map-matched path on an image of the map.
-
公开(公告)号:US20240401967A1
公开(公告)日:2024-12-05
申请号:US18680877
申请日:2024-05-31
Applicant: Apple Inc.
Inventor: Kenneth M. Pesyna, JR. , Aditya Marawar , Christina Selle , Isaac T. Miller , Saurabh Godha
IPC: G01C21/36
Abstract: Techniques are described herein for low-power pedestrian route reconstruction. A method can include accessing location data comprising a set of location points collected by a user device during a workout and defining an initial route. The method can further include accessing map data comprising a plurality of paths within a geographic region. The method can further include, for a plurality of location point pairs of the set of location points, determining a route segment between the pair of location points that follows a path segment of the plurality of paths. The method can further include combining route segments for each location point pair of the plurality of location point pairs to define a reconstructed route that begins with a first location route pair based on an initial location point and ends with a second location route pair based on a final location point.
-
公开(公告)号:US11943679B2
公开(公告)日:2024-03-26
申请号:US17861167
申请日:2022-07-08
Applicant: Apple Inc.
Inventor: Robert William Mayor , Isaac T. Miller , Adam S. Howell , Vinay R. Majjigi , Oliver Ruepp , Daniel Ulbricht , Oleg Naroditsky , Christian Lipski , Sean P. Cier , Hyojoon Bae , Saurabh Godha , Patrick J. Coleman
IPC: H04W4/024 , G01C21/36 , G06T7/73 , G06V10/44 , G06V10/80 , G06V20/10 , H04M1/724 , H04W4/02 , H04W64/00
CPC classification number: H04W4/024 , G01C21/3647 , G06T7/74 , G06V10/44 , G06V10/806 , G06V20/10 , H04M1/724 , H04W4/026 , G06T2207/30244 , H04M2250/52 , H04W64/006
Abstract: Location mapping and navigation user interfaces may be generated and presented via mobile computing devices. A mobile device may detect its location and orientation using internal systems, and may capture image data using a device camera. The mobile device also may retrieve map information from a map server corresponding to the current location of the device. Using the image data captured at the device, the current location data, and the corresponding local map information, the mobile device may determine or update a current orientation reading for the device. Location errors and updated location data also may be determined for the device, and a map user interface may be generated and displayed on the mobile device using the updated device orientation and/or location data.
-
-
-
-
-
-
-
-
-